Where is the solar plexus located in dogs? - in detail

The solar plexus, also known as the celiac plexus, is a complex network of nerves located in the abdominal region of dogs. This intricate structure is situated just below the diaphragm, which is the muscular partition that separates the thoracic cavity from the abdominal cavity. The solar plexus is a critical component of the autonomic nervous system, responsible for regulating various involuntary functions within the body.

In dogs, the solar plexus is positioned in the cranial part of the abdomen, specifically around the level of the first lumbar vertebra. This location places it near the aorta, the major artery that supplies blood to the lower body, and the celiac artery, which branches off from the aorta to provide blood to the stomach, liver, spleen, and other abdominal organs. The precise anatomical location of the solar plexus makes it a central hub for the transmission of nerve signals between the brain and the abdominal organs.

The solar plexus is composed of several ganglia, which are clusters of nerve cell bodies. These ganglia receive and integrate signals from both the sympathetic and parasympathetic divisions of the autonomic nervous system. The sympathetic nerves originate from the thoracic spinal cord and are responsible for the "fight or flight" response, while the parasympathetic nerves originate from the cranial nerves and are involved in the "rest and digest" functions. The integration of these signals allows the solar plexus to modulate various physiological processes, including digestion, blood flow, and immune responses.
